HandyCat: Bees-Ness as Usual is a 7-minute animated short film created by Russ Harris and G. Brian (Jerry) Reynolds. It aired on Nicktoons Network's Random! Cartoons in 2009.[1]

Plot

Handycat and his dog Drillbit are hired to remove an exceptionally large beehive.

Production notes

HandyCat is the final short to premiere on Random! Cartoons at Nicktoons Network. Russ Harris and Jerry Reynolds are the oldest animators and cartoonists to work with Fred Seibert. They previously collaborated with him producing "O Ratz!" a short for the What A Cartoon! series on Cartoon Network. The storyboard and writing was done at Frederator Studios, the voice recordings was done at Nickelodeon Studios and the animation was done at Perennial Pictures in Indianapolis, Indiana. This is Perennial Pictures' first Flash animation project convinced by Fred to do so and now the studio does both traditional methods and Flash animation. It aired in August 2009.
